Exploring the intricacies of financial decision-making, this book highlights key biases that influence human behavior, including over-confidence, naïve extrapolation, attention, and risk aversion. It delves into how these biases can lead both investors and corporations to make significant errors in their investment choices, offering valuable insights into improving decision-making processes in the financial realm.
